PAS 13 tested polymer pedestrian safety barrier manufactured from high-density polyethylene (HDPE). Double bumper design provides high visibility pedestrian safety protection and impact resistance.
The Double Bumper Pedestrian Safety Barrier is designed to provide effective separation between pedestrians and material handling equipment (MHE) in warehouse, logistics and industrial environments where vehicle and pedestrian interaction presents an operational risk.
Its elevated pedestrian rail system combined with dual impact bumpers provides both clear pedestrian route definition and low-level vehicle impact protection. This makes the barrier particularly suitable for environments where forklifts, pallet trucks and other MHE operate alongside personnel.

The Double Bumper Pedestrian Safety Barrier is a PAS 13 tested polymer barrier designed to provide effective separation between pedestrians and material handling equipment (MHE) in warehouse, logistics and industrial environments.
Manufactured from flexible high-density polyethylene (HDPE) with mild steel base plates, the barrier incorporates a dual bumper rail configuration that increases impact deflection and structural resilience. When struck by moving equipment, the barrier deflects under impact and reforms to shape, helping reduce damage to floors, anchor points and surrounding infrastructure when compared with rigid steel barrier systems.
The barrier system is specifically designed for environments where pedestrian traffic and forklift operations occur in close proximity. The elevated pedestrian rail configuration combined with the double bumper impact rails provides both clear pedestrian segregation and low-level vehicle impact protection.
This dual function makes the barrier particularly effective within warehouse traffic management systems aligned with PAS 13 guidance, where the separation of pedestrians and vehicles forms a core component of operational safety planning.
High visibility Safety Yellow and Grey colouring further improves operator awareness and defines safe working boundaries within busy operational environments.

Impact Performance and Testing
The Double Bumper Pedestrian Safety Barrier has been independently tested and certified by TÜV Nord in accordance with PAS 13.
Testing demonstrated the barrier absorbed:
These results are equivalent to a 3,500 kg forklift travelling at 6.4 mph, with measured barrier deflection of 232 mm when installed on a concrete substrate.
This controlled deflection behaviour allows the barrier to absorb and dissipate collision energy, reducing the likelihood of structural damage to the barrier system and surrounding infrastructure.
Unlike rigid steel barriers, the flexible polymer construction reduces the transfer of impact forces into floor anchors and concrete substrates, helping minimise maintenance and repair costs following low-level impacts.
Material and Construction
The barrier system is manufactured from:
The HDPE material provides a combination of flexibility, durability and high visibility that is well suited to demanding industrial environments.
Unlike painted steel barrier systems, polymer barriers require minimal maintenance and are resistant to corrosion, moisture and general environmental wear.
The material composition is fully recyclable and non-toxic, making the barrier suitable for environments where hygiene and durability are important considerations.
